Output 34301fc156e199eafd4c40926753f4fdd2b26c4f30870c39d5ec308a8e6e47cd:1

value
66083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33837c3539adf4c4cecd85d5aa063d15e395ebaa OP_EQUALVERIFY OP_CHECKSIG
address
15hNyXzSLBEw4dLgLKS1YXnUJSsUCnZzhP
transaction
34301fc156e199eafd4c40926753f4fdd2b26c4f30870c39d5ec308a8e6e47cd